*National French Fry Day has always been July 13, but a petition was passed last year to move it to always be the second Friday of July. Get it Fry-Day… Friday…
That means that tomorrow (Friday, July 14) is technically National French Fry Day, however McDonald’s is holding on to history and is celebrating today anyways. Learn more in the Deal of the Week section below.

Tornado in Chicago: Chicago has had quite the summer already in terms of atypical severe weather occurrences including wildfire smoke, flooding and now a tornado too. ICYMI, but your phone alerts probably didn’t let you, a tornado touched down near O’Hare airport and other parts of Chicagoland yesterday evening. People were forced to shelter in place in the airport. Take a look at the scenes from O’Hare and videos people captured elsewhere yesterday.
Taste of Randolph Scheme: Did you know that Chicago street festivals cannot charge a mandatory entrance fee? Instead they are allowed to request an optional donation. This didn’t stop one West Loop festival as event organizers for Taste of Randolph got caught selling festival tickets online.
Coke vs Pepsi: The United Center just announced this week that they are changing their beverage supplier partnership in advance of the upcoming Bulls and Blackhawks season. PepsiCo will now be the official soft drink provider, replacing Coca-Cola, as they have entered into a new multi-year partnership.
Best High Schools: A new list of the 50 best high schools in the country came out, and Illinois absolutely dominated the list with 10 high schools making the top 50. Stevenson made the top 10 in the entire country yet was still beat out by one other Illinois school. See which Illinois high schools made the cut and their rankings.
Northwestern Scandal: At this point, you have likely heard about the mess that has been unfolding with the football team at Northwestern University in Evanston. If not, there was a hazing scandal that the long-time head coach Pat Fitzgerald has since been fired for. However, in a highly-debated move, the school decided to keep all of its assistant coaches for this season and make the defensive coordinator the new head coach. Learn more.
